Address

NbfpkAxBCRz3M66aYhj3jsaTZQLNqQ5dPu

0 XNA

Confirmed
Total Received780.07200372 XNA
Total Sent780.07200372 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NbfpkAxBCRz3M66aYhj3jsaTZQLNqQ5dPu780.07200372 XNA
 
 
NbfpkAxBCRz3M66aYhj3jsaTZQLNqQ5dPu780.07200372 XNA